| from typing import Optional | |
| import cutlass | |
| import cutlass.cute as cute | |
| """ | |
| This consolidates all the info related to sequence length. This is so that we can do all | |
| the gmem reads once at the beginning of each tile, rather than having to repeat these reads | |
| to compute various things like n_block_min, n_block_max, etc. | |
| """ | |
| class SeqlenInfo: | |
| def __init__( | |
| self, | |
| batch_idx: cutlass.Int32, | |
| seqlen_static: cutlass.Int32, | |
| cu_seqlens: Optional[cute.Tensor] = None, | |
| seqused: Optional[cute.Tensor] = None, | |
| ): | |
| self.offset = 0 if cutlass.const_expr(cu_seqlens is None) else cu_seqlens[batch_idx] | |
| if cutlass.const_expr(seqused is not None): | |
| self.seqlen = seqused[batch_idx] | |
| elif cutlass.const_expr(cu_seqlens is not None): | |
| self.seqlen = cu_seqlens[batch_idx + 1] - cu_seqlens[batch_idx] | |
| else: | |
| self.seqlen = seqlen_static | |
| class SeqlenInfoQK: | |
| def __init__( | |
| self, | |
| batch_idx: cutlass.Int32, | |
| seqlen_q_static: cutlass.Int32, | |
| seqlen_k_static: cutlass.Int32, | |
| mCuSeqlensQ: Optional[cute.Tensor] = None, | |
| mCuSeqlensK: Optional[cute.Tensor] = None, | |
| mSeqUsedQ: Optional[cute.Tensor] = None, | |
| mSeqUsedK: Optional[cute.Tensor] = None, | |
| ): | |
| self.offset_q = 0 if cutlass.const_expr(mCuSeqlensQ is None) else mCuSeqlensQ[batch_idx] | |
| self.offset_k = 0 if cutlass.const_expr(mCuSeqlensK is None) else mCuSeqlensK[batch_idx] | |
| if cutlass.const_expr(mSeqUsedQ is not None): | |
| self.seqlen_q = mSeqUsedQ[batch_idx] | |
| else: | |
| self.seqlen_q = ( | |
| seqlen_q_static | |
| if cutlass.const_expr(mCuSeqlensQ is None) | |
| else mCuSeqlensQ[batch_idx + 1] - self.offset_q | |
| ) | |
| if cutlass.const_expr(mSeqUsedK is not None): | |
| self.seqlen_k = mSeqUsedK[batch_idx] | |
| else: | |
| self.seqlen_k = ( | |
| seqlen_k_static | |
| if cutlass.const_expr(mCuSeqlensK is None) | |
| else mCuSeqlensK[batch_idx + 1] - self.offset_k | |
| ) | |
| self.has_cu_seqlens_q: int = mCuSeqlensQ is not None | |
| self.has_cu_seqlens_k: int = mCuSeqlensK is not None | |
